almost 18 month old completely off his food.. even sweets!!

2 replies

lunarx · 13/12/2005 15:08

ds is teething. one canine. one molar. i've given nurofen (to no avail it seems ) and as a result of this, he is completely off his food. even his normal favourites (including sweet things like raisins and he even turned down chocolate buttons at playgroup this morning!!)

offering him food is proving useless today (though i'll continue too, just in case..)

for other moms this has happened to, or is happening to with their children, what are you doing for your child's daily nutrition? right now, ds will only have formula (or whole milk, but i'm opting for formula as its got more in it..)

sigh...

my dd is 2.2 and has some teeth coming through and although not completely off her food is certainly eating a lot less. She s not drinking much either. Had a total of 9 oz of fluid (milk and water) today! I shouldn't worry too much about not eating, as long as they're drinking - that's more important. Just keep offering food - i tend to put a few bits and pieces on a plate on the floor of where she's playing and then she helps herself (obviously not all the time but when she's not eating normally). It's horrible I know - just wish I know how i could get her to drink!!!!

It really isn't worth thinking of daily nutrition at this age - I'd think about daily fluid intake, and weekly, or monthly, nutrition.

Just keep offering, and don't get stressed.
